Using these in your classroom
Teachers can use these resources in various instructional settings. For whole-group lessons, display a graphic organizer to model planning for a narrative or opinion piece. In small groups, students can work on expanding topics with facts or writing conclusions together. Literacy centers can feature writing prompts or digital tools for independent practice. Use these materials for homework to reinforce skills taught in class, or for intervention with students who need extra support. Differentiated worksheets allow struggling writers to focus on fundamentals while advanced students tackle more complex prompts. These resources also work well for review before assessments, helping students practice key writing skills in a structured way.
Standards alignment
These resources are aligned to grade-level Common Core writing standards for Grade 6, including skills in argumentative, informative, and narrative writing, as well as research and use of technology. They support standards for writing with clear organization, relevant details, and appropriate conventions.
